Our dates for the last three or four years range somewhere between a start date of May 23rd and departure date of June 6th. Last trip, we were there May 26th through June 5th which included the Memorial Day holiday. The crowds have always been manageable. We aren't rope drop people but do arrive at the parks within the first 1/2 hour to hour of opening and make use of the Fastpass system.

I have seen the wait times for the major attractions like Soarin', Test Track, Expedition Everest, Splash Mountain, etc. be posted at 60 minutes or more. Having said that, those times were usually late morning/early afternoon and weren't quite as bad later in the day. Again, we use Fastpass for the major attractions and are able to bypass the long wait times.

This past trip, we were very pleasantly surprised by the wait times. On the days leading up to Memorial Day, most were under 30 minutes and most were less than that. I even sent a text to several of my Disboards friends telling them how short the wait times were. (We are of the mindframe that a 30 minute or less wait time is not worth wasting a Fastpass on.)

We did go to Star Wars weekend and it was busy but we had expected that. There were a few things that we didn't get to do because we were doing Star Wars Weekend related things.

Oh and we didn't go to a park on Memorial Day itself. We used that day as one of our "down days" and spent the day at the resort and ate at DTD.
